Warning Signs You Need Water Damage Reconstruction
Catching water dam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some warning sign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ors in your home or business can be a sign of hidden water damage. Don’t ignore these smells, they can be a sign of mold growth or other serious issues.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Water damage can cause your flooring to warp or buckle, creating an uneven surface that’s difficult to walk on. If you notice this happening, it’s time to call a professional.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Water damage can cause paint or wallpaper to peel or bubble, revealing underlying issues with your walls or ceilings.
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ls
Water stains can be a sign of a more serious issue, such as a leaky roof or burst pipe.
Unusual Noises or Sounds
Unusual noises or sounds in your walls or ceilings can be a sign of hidden water damage or structural issues.
High Humidity or Moisture Levels
High humidity or moisture levels in your home or business can be a sign of water damage or other issues.

Water Damage Reconstruction Cost In Scranton, PA
The cost of Water Damage Reconstruction in Scranton, PA, can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Structural repairs | $1,000 – $5,000 | Materials needed, complexity of repairs |
| Final inspection and cleanup |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, level of detail required |
| Insurance claims processing | $100 – $500 | Complexity of claims process, number of claims |
| Specialized equipment rental | $500 – $2,000 | Duration of rental, type of equipment needed |
| More repairs (e.g., drywall, flooring) |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, level of damage |
